War Made Invisible

How America Hides the Human Toll of Its Military Machine
By Norman Solomon


The August 2023 edition of ColdType e-magazine features an exclusive excerpt from War Made Invisible: How America Hides the Human Toll of Its Military Machine, by RootsAction national director Norman Solomon. War Made Invisible is a searing new exposé of how the American military, with the help of the media, conceals its perpetual war.
